Get startedWoodside is a detached house in Rushmoor, Farnham, Farnham (GU10 2ET). It has a recorded floor area of 194 m² (around 2088 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(February 2023)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in March 2010 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 75).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 5.1%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£474/sq ft) was about 33%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 194 m² the property is well over the postcode median (118 m² across 18 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2025.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Sold March 2024 for £990,000.
